写入excel时文件名加入当前时间

问题遇到的现象和发生背景

to_excel写入文档时想要在文件名中加入时间:比如下面代码,生成的exel文件名:结果20220708001517.xlsx,日期后面是时间00:15:17

问题相关代码,请勿粘贴截图

data = {"序号": index, "名称": name, "重量": num, "单位": unit, "价格/斤": prices, '金额': amounts}
##5.创建DataFrame表格
df = pd.DataFrame(data)
##5.写入excel
df.to_excel(r'C:\Users\Administrator\Desktop\结果.xlsx', index=None)

运行结果及报错内容
我的解答思路和尝试过的方法
我想要达到的结果

img

import time
import pandas as pd

df=pd.DataFrame({
    'ID':['aaa','bbb','bbb','aaa'],
    '金额':[500,200,-300,-200]
})
t = time.strftime('%Y%m%d%H%M%S', time.localtime(time.time()))
print(t)
df.to_excel(rf'C:\Users\Administrator\Desktop\结果{t}.xlsx', index=None)

如有帮助,请点击我的回答下方的【采纳该答案】按钮帮忙采纳下,谢谢!

img

您好,我是有问必答小助手,您的问题已经有小伙伴帮您解答,感谢您对有问必答的支持与关注!
PS:问答VIP年卡 【限时加赠:IT技术图书免费领】,了解详情>>> https://vip.csdn.net/askvip?utm_source=1146287632